Output ec07017125f350e929aaa738498726c8b57b60a6596767d6d01a3e8c66e97a26:1

value
1562989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f073726c763092a668fba165f6532c4a0b11cab OP_EQUALVERIFY OP_CHECKSIG
address
1CafThapZLzzoBMnUz1aAF1sNBhmCPY5N9
transaction
ec07017125f350e929aaa738498726c8b57b60a6596767d6d01a3e8c66e97a26
spent
true